Two bonds that pay semiannual coupons are currently trading in the market. Bond R has one year to maturity, a face value of $100, and an annual coupon rate of 4% (APR). Bond Q also has one year to maturity, a face value of $100, and an annual coupon rate of 8% (APR). Bond R is currently priced at $98.12, while Bond Q is priced at $102.40. Using these market prices, calculate the two-semiannual period (1-year) spot rate expressed as an APR compounded semiannually (i.e., APR with m=2).
